摘 要:基于色谱-质谱和色谱-质谱-质谱分析,通过对比塔里木盆地塔中地区不同原油中8,14-开环藿烷系列分布与组成特征来探讨其在油源研究中的意义。结果表明,在塔里木盆地塔中地区两类海相端元油中同时检测到C35+长链藿烷系列和3个系列的8,14-开环藿烷,且呈现出不同的分布特点,表明它们可能具有特定的地球化学意义。研究区端元油中两类标志物的存在表明它们具有原生性,而与生物降解作用无关。对比发现不同类型原油中8,14-开环藿烷系列的含量存在显著差异,A类油明显低于B类油,端元油低于相应的混源油。依据8,14-开环藿烷相对含量,结合甾烷、萜烷组成特征,可以将塔中地区不同类型原油进行区分。A类油与B类油中8,14-开环藿烷相对丰度上的明显反差说明此类标志物的形成可能需要特定的地质-地球化学条件。图10表2参44。8,14-secohopanes in the marine oils from the Tazhong area in the Tarim Basin are detected by gas chromatography-mass spectrometry(GC-MS) and GC-MS-MS, and their distributions and compositions are compared in order to study their potential significances in oil-source correlation. C35+ long chain hopane series and three series of extended 8,14-secohopanes can be detected in two kinds of end-member oils in the Tazhong area in the Tarim Basin, and they are different in distribution, suggesting that they may have some special geochemical significances. The presence of 8,14-secohopanes in two kinds of end-member oils in the Tarim Basin suggest that these biomarkers are primary, and not related to biodegradation. The relative abundance of 8,14-secohopanes in the type-A oil is much less than that in the type-B oil, and the 8,14-secohopanes content in end-member oils is much less than that in the corresponding mixed oils. Based on the relative contents of 8,14-secohopanes and the compositions of common steranes and triterpanes, it is very effective to distinguish different crude oils from the Tazhong area. The great difference in the relative abundance of 8,14-secohopanes between the type-A oil and type-B oil suggests that their formation may require some specific geologicalgeochemical conditions.
